Nestled in the heart of the North Country, Canton, NY is a hidden gem that welcomes travelers with open arms. You might just know it best as home to St. Lawrence University, where the vibrant campus adds a youthful energy to this charming town. As you stroll along the tree-lined streets, you'll discover a tapestry of local shops and eateries that offer a taste of the town's unique character.
Nature enthusiasts can head to nearby Higley Flow State Park for hiking and picturesque picnic spots, perfect for soaking in the serene surroundings. History buffs, don't miss the St. Lawrence County Historical Association, where the local lore is as rich as the landscape.

Nestled in New York's picturesque Finger Lakes region, this town is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ts and culture seekers alike.
Start your journey at Greek Peak Mountain Resort, a must-visit no matter the season. In winter, it's perfect for skiing, and in summer, hiking trails and zip-lining await. History buffs shouldn't miss the 1890 House Museum, a beautifully preserved time capsule. Family fun? Check out the Cortland Repertory Theatre for live, local performances.
Craft beer lovers can raise a glass at the local breweries, serving some of the tastiest suds around. Plus, Main Street is lined with boutique shops and delightful eateries that are proudly unique to the town.
